The Directorate of Nursing and Midwifery Services oversee the implementation of Hospital Based Nursing Services (Nursing Education), Community Health Nursing Services and Quality Assurance Services. Funding for the activities is from Malawi Government ORT. Some activities on the other programs like Community Home Based Nursing are also funded fromĀ National AIDS Commission (NAC), PACT through the Palliative Care Association of Malawi (PACAM), GTZ and WHO. Vision The vision of nursing/midwifery services is to promote excellence in the delivery of nursing and midwifery care services at all levels in order to improve quality of life of all people in Malawi. Mision The Mission of Nursing/Midwifery Services in Malawi is to assist individuals, families, groups and communities to attain a high level of well being by providing promotive, preventive, curative, rehabilitative and palliative nursing/midwifery services at all levels of health care delivery system.
